We are a small church… and that’s a good thing!

Too often folks get left behind in a large congregation. To solve this problem many large churches create Care Groups to allow personal relationships to grow - a necessity of Christian living.

This isn’t necessary with a small church. We all get to know each other.

A small church includes all! There is warmth & closeness. There is concern and willingness to help one another but also respect of each other’s privacy. The congregation becomes more family-like and more Christ-like. Everyone pitches in to make the church work for everyone’s benefit!
